One of the most effective practices for gig workers: every time a platform payment hits your account, immediately transfer 27–30% to a separate savings goal labelled "Tax Reserve." KOHO's savings goals make this automatic.
By the time March or April arrives, your tax money is already set aside. No scrambling. No CRA interest charges. No payment plan negotiations. Just a clean payment from funds you set aside throughout the year.
Once you register for HST, you're collecting tax on behalf of the CRA. That money isn't yours — it needs to be remitted. Keep HST collected in a separate savings goal or sub-account. A common mistake: spending collected HST and then not having funds to remit. Avoid this by treating HST collected as untouchable from day one.
